页面

2008-05-21

jdb调试tomcat应用

  1. 首先导出两个环境变量:
  2. $ export JPDA_ADDRESS=8000
    $ export JPDA_TRANSPORT=dt_socket
  3. 挂载jpda参数启动tomcat:
    $ catalina.sh jpda start
  4. 启动jdb:
    $ jdb -connect com.sun.jdi.SocketAttach:port=8000
  5. 对需要进行调试的类加“-g”参数进行编译,否则在调试过程中通过locals指令无法获取本地变量值。
参考:http://wiki.apache.org/tomcat/FAQ/Developing#Q1

没有评论: